High Performance, Low Power MPC8313E Powers Everyday Applications


Page Contents:   [ Featured Products | Datasheets | Application Notes | Buy Now ]


See it First - Buy it First

Many segments of the industry are moving toward more feature rich, highly integrated processors that consume less power. With this in mind, Freescale created the MPC8313E Power-QUICC™ integrated communications processor to meet performance, power and security needs for digital media servers, consumer network attached storage, office, media, financial and industrial applications. Based on mature Power Architecture™ technology, this processor offers designers easy scalability, many features integrated on-chip and the possibility of significant software reuse across product families. This can speed up development and reduce product sustaining costs.


Satisfying Ever Changing, Multiple Market Needs...
While different markets require different product solutions, the same key processor attributes often apply across consumer, commercial and industrial applications. So it only makes sense that a company like Freescale, known for its design and integration capabilities, should produce the MPC8313E PowerQUICC™ processor, to integrate hardware for Ethernet and serial communications, memory interfaces, USB ports, security and other popular inputs and outputs in a ubiquitous architecture to serve several markets equally well.

The MPC8313E serves end users with high performance, security and integrated software, providing reliability and ease of use. Designers benefit from its legacy SoC, lower pin count and high speed peripherals like SGMII and DDRII. Freescale also offers designers a cost effective evaluation board and drivers for the MPC8313E as well as CodeWarrior® development tools that will help speed a design to market.

 

Industrial Automation

  • Integrated Ethernet controllers support industrial Ethernet protocols for access to networked devices on the factory floor
  • Integrated Serial communications and DDR2 Memory controllers reduce system chip count
  • IEEE1588 hardware support gives nanosecond level clock synchronization accuracy for this most popular industrial clock synchronization protocol
  • Boot from NAND Flash reduces system cost
  • Junction temperature range -40° to 105°C supports fanless designs in harsh environments

Enhancing the Office and Industrial Markets with Sensible Standards...

By complying with Advanced Configuration and Power Interface (ACPI) standards, which define common interfaces for hardware recognition, device configuration and power management, the MPC8313E brings fast, secure hardcopy printing to offices of all sizes. These standards also help to ensure that processors achieve an extremely low power consumption state. For example, the MPC8313E consumes less than 300mW on standby power and is optimized to “sleep” until tapped by another device to wake up and get to work, thereby saving power.

For extremely precise clock synchronization for applications such as time sensitive telecommunications services, industrial network switches, powerline networks and test and measurement devices, the MPC8313E features integrated IEEE1588 time synchronization, the leading edge standard. Freescale has partnered with IXXAT to deliver IEEE1588 support.

MPC8313E Block Diagram

 

Specifications MPC8313E
CPU Core e300 c3
CPU Frequency 266 to 333MHz
MIPs 510-639
Cache (I/D) 16K/16K
DDR2 Controller 1 x 16/32-bit
DDR2 Frequency 333
PCI 32-bit 2.3
USB 1x High-Speed 2.0 w/PHY
Security Core 2.2
FPU Yes
10/100/1000
Ethernet
2
SGMII,RGMII, RTBI, (R) MII
UART Dual
I2C Dual
SPI Single
Package 516 Te PBGA
Process Technology 90nm
Estimated Max Power <2W
